Buster Gay
Buster Gay, born John H. Gay Sr., founded the Gay Fish Company on St. Helena Island, SC. In 1948, after working as an electrician at the Beaufort Naval Hospital, Buster recognized the more significant opportunities in shrimping. He began shrimping on weekends and eventually invested in a larger boat and the property where Gay Fish Company now stands. Buster and his wife, Hilda, built the business from the ground up, turning it into a cornerstone of the local community. Their hard work and dedication laid the foundation for what has become a multi-generational, family-run company. Buster passed down not only the skills of the trade to his children but also the values of hard work, honesty, and community support, which still guide the company today.
Charles Gay
Charles Gay, now in his late 70s, has been a pivotal figure in running the Gay Fish Company. Growing up in the business, Charles learned the trade from a young age, working with his siblings in the day-to-day operations. He remains actively involved in the company, working six days a week and overseeing the operations, including raising the American flag each morning at 10 a.m. Charles is known for his dedication to the business and is essential to its success, ensuring the traditions established by his parents continue.

Cyndy Gay Carr
Cyndy Gay Carr serves as the business manager of Gay Fish Company, stepping into the role after a successful career in home mortgage loans. Raised on St. Helena Island, Cyndy grew up surrounded by the family business founded by her grandparents, John H. Gay Sr. and Hilda S. Gay, in 1948. She transitioned to the seafood industry in 2022, working alongside her father, Charles Gay, her uncle Robert Gay, and her brother Tim Gay. Cyndy is passionate about continuing her family’s legacy and modernizing the business, including growing their social media presence. She is also focused on maintaining the company's traditional values and supporting local shrimpers.
Tim Gay
Tim Gay, Cyndy's brother, worked on boats during his teenage years before pursuing ROTC in college. He then joined the Army, served in Desert Storm, and has since retired from military service. Now, he owns a private government contracting firm and is the majority owner of GFC, although he entrusts the day-to-day operations to Cyndy and his father.
